Long a critic of the PM, Douglas Ross cites Ukraine war and says now is no time for change of leadership

The Scottish Conservative leader, Douglas Ross, has withdrawn his letter of no confidence in Boris Johnson, citing the war in Ukraine and saying it was no time for a change of leadership.

Ross, who has been an outspoken critic of the prime minister, had criticised him over lockdown parties in Downing Street. Johnson, along with dozens of staff and officials, is under police investigation for the breaches.
